Salary & Budget Planning

The estimated average net salary in Marawi City is ₱26,044 ($445) per month. To live comfortably — covering the full single-person budget of ₱25,920 ($443) with about 30% left over for savings — you would need a net income of roughly ₱33,696 ($576) per month.

Housing takes the largest share: rent for a one-bedroom outside the centre (₱8,557 ($146)) represents about 33% of the total single-person budget.
